About the position

As an Accounting Manager at Cummins, you will play a pivotal role in overseeing specialized accounting functions within the Components Business Segment in Hartford, CT. This position is designed for a professional who is not only adept at managing complex accounting processes but also possesses the leadership skills necessary to guide a team of accountants. You will be responsible for maintaining the department's general ledger, ensuring the accuracy and timeliness of accounting transactions, and resolving any complex accounting issues that may arise from both routine and non-routine transactions. Your expertise will be crucial in reviewing general ledger entries, account reconciliations, and various internal and external reports, ensuring compliance with financial regulations and internal controls. In this role, you will also be tasked with developing and implementing new internal controls as necessary, making recommendations to enhance accounting processes, and ensuring adherence to new accounting standards. You will provide training to both new and existing staff, fostering a culture of continuous improvement and professional development within your team. Your ability to communicate effectively with management, auditors, and other stakeholders will be essential as you respond to inquiries regarding financial results and special reporting requests. Responsibilities

  • Perform and oversee specialized accounting work to maintain the department's general ledger.
  • Resolve complex accounting issues from routine and non-routine transactions.
  • Manage a team of accountants and oversee complex processes that interact with multiple individuals outside the department.
  • Ensure timely recording, analyzing, and reporting of accounting transactions.
  • Review general ledger entries, account reconciliations, and internal and external reports.
  • Respond to inquiries from management, auditors, and other stakeholders regarding financial results.
  • Review existing internal controls and develop new controls as necessary.
  • Make and implement recommendations to improve accounting processes and procedures.
  • Implement new accounting standards and provide training to staff as needed.
  • Protect the organization's value by maintaining confidentiality of information.

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, or a related field required.
  • Certified Public Accountant (CPA), Certified Management Accountant (CMA), Chartered Accountant, or similar certification required.
  • Significant experience in accounting, including supervisory experience.
  • Experience in manufacturing plant and complex accounting processes.
  • Knowledge of finance systems and tools such as Oracle, Bolt, JDE, Planful, and HFM is preferred.
  • Ability to communicate effectively and develop talent within the team.
  • Experience in evaluating business processes to identify risks and internal control gaps.
